Gino Cingolani is a structural biologist whose research centers on the molecular machinery of viral infection, with a particular focus on bacteriophages and the mechanisms by which they package and deliver their genetic material. His major contributions lie in elucidating the three-dimensional structures of viral proteins that are critical for capsid assembly and DNA stabilization. In his notable work on the bacteriophage P22 tail accessory factor gp26, Cingolani revealed that this protein, essential for stabilizing viral DNA within the mature capsid, exists as an extended triple-stranded coiled-coil. This finding was striking because it demonstrated profound structural similarities between a phage accessory factor and class I viral membrane-fusion proteins, suggesting a conserved evolutionary architecture across diverse viral systems.
